Default What servos do you use in your mx-400 , mx450xs

I had a shogun 400 that I crashed a few months ago and it's not worth repairing. I been looking for the best heli for the money and Im sure it's the Helimax Mx-450xs from Tower Hobbies.
I have Hitec Hs-55 servos in the shogun and they worked fine for my flying skills at the time. Im on a limited budget and thinking they will work in the MX-450xs for now. The collective servo stripped on that crash, so I need to buy one servo with the Mx450 and Im thinking of buying a better servo for the tail. Any suggestions ???

unless you are into heavy 3d flying you should be fine with HS65HB servos
all 'round.

I run 4 HS65HB on my MX400Pro, if you want a little more speed and torque run a 6V bec.
